1 Starter problem of the 2003 Honda Civic Hybrid

Failure Date: 06/02/2015

I bought this car off of a private seller few months ago when the car was around 99000 miles, used it to commute from and to work (6 miles drive), and couple of road trips from boston to rhode island. The car was working perfectly fine, I was really happy with it, until last week when the car started to startle when I come to a complete stop and hit the gas again. I just figured its time for an oil change so I took it in to meineke but the jitter would not go away, the guy from meineke told me it could be a motor problem. So I took the car to a mechanic and they said its the starter clutch. I did some digging around on the different forums and figured out this is a very common problem for first gen hch. I was actually surprised by the amount of complaints I was able to find on edmunds, kbb, autraders, and cars. Com knowing how reliable Hondas usually are (I personally drove two Hondas before, and never had any problems). Seeing the amount of complaints, why isn't there a recall being issued for this dilemma. Honda should really try to fix this issue, or loyal customers such as myself would start to walk.

2 Starter problem of the 2008 Honda Civic Hybrid

Failure Date: 10/03/2011

The battery on my Honda Civic Hybrid has been failing to charge which means my car has no power to move quickly up hills or accelerate when I need to especially as I am merging onto the freeway. There have been numerous dangerous occasions where I may have been the first car at a traffic light, the light will turn green but my car has no power to make it up the hill. There has also been incidents when I am merging onto the freeway but can't get my car to accelerate to an appropriate speed as to not be a danger to the cars already on the freeway. I pray to god that there is not an 18 wheeler approaching behind me in the right lane or the driver would not be able to slow down in time to allow me to merge onto the freeway. There has also been times where my car will not start up immediately in the morning. I have already replaced the starter battery from the Honda dealership that cost me over $200. 00 after their mandatory adjustment on the ima battery. Honda will not replace my ima battery until the light comes on the dashboard. My car is not yet 4 years old but the battery is already a danger to my safety. Something needs to be done before somebody gets killed in their Honda hybrid for failing to accelerate at the appropriate times.

3 Starter problem of the 2004 Honda Civic Hybrid

Failure Date: 02/28/2007

Honda Civic Hybrid 2004 model car stopped briefly for passenger pickup, or for putting gas in a gas station, does not start for over 10 minutes and then starts up. It has happened 3 or 4 times in the past 2 months.

4 Starter problem of the 2003 Honda Civic Hybrid

Failure Date: 04/15/2006

- the contact stated while driving the 2003 Honda civic hibrid ( at 50 mph and merging onto the interstate the vehicle began to lose power. It regained power by accelerating, but the vehicle jerked back and forward. The vehicle had to be driven slowly until it got up to proper speed. The mechanic stated that the egr valve, the starter gear and the flywheel failed. The vehicle was still not working properly.
